Campbell-Ewald CEO Bill Ludwig To Depart Detroit Agency
Posted in: UncategorizedHere’s a puzzler: the same week an agency nails a big account, the CEO leaves.
Bill Ludwig, the chairman-CEO at Campbell-Ewald, is stepping down at the Detroit-based shop after more than 30 years, according to executives familiar with the matter. The agency is expected to tap an internal successor in a matter of weeks. The top contender for the spot? Jim Palmer, currently the agency’s chief client officer. Various other execs at the agency are expected to be promoted under Mr. Palmer.
Representatives for Campbell-Ewald said only: "The executive team at CE is in place." The agency’s parent, Interpublic Group of Cos., said: "It’s our policy not to comment on rumors, especially ones that involve individuals or personnel."
